Wetter in Bernkastel-Kues refers to the weather conditions in the town of Bernkastel-Kues, located in the Moselle valley in western Germany.
The climate in Bernkastel-Kues is temperate, with warm summers and mild winters. The average temperature throughout the year is 10C (50F). The town receives an average of 700 mm (28 inches) of precipitation per year, which is spread fairly evenly throughout the year.
The weather in Bernkastel-Kues is important for a number of reasons. The town’s economy is heavily dependent on tourism, and the weather can have a significant impact on the number of visitors. The weather also plays a role in the town’s agriculture, as the grapes grown in the Moselle valley are sensitive to temperature and precipitation.
